Basic Care & Requirements

 

Housing

Steppe lemmings are escape artists and as such should be housed in a glass or plastic tank as the bars on standad hampster cages are too wide

As lemmings are a social species they should never be housed alone they do best in pairs or a group altho fighting may occure if there is a problem with over crowding or housing too many males to females

My lemmings are housed in a smaller indoor rabbit cage with a 6" deep mix of wood shaving and hay for them to dig and nest in

Diet

It is thought that the steppe lemming is sugar intoerant and prone to diabetes as a result they should not be fed anything with a high sugar content

As part of my diet i use a guinea pig food, fresh veg, millet spray, fresh grass and hay

Sexing

female

Male steppe lemmings are easily distinguished by the prominent bulge of the testes also the anal-genital gap is around double the width in the male as the female
